Kentucky House Bill 49
Session 2022RS
AN ACT relating to changes in pension payments due to overtime worked during a local emergency and declaring an emergency.
Became Law
Became Law
Signed by Governor on Apr 8, 2022

Summary
Amend KRS 61.598 to exempt from the anti-pension spiking provisions any overtime directly attributable to a local government emergency in which the Governor calls in the Kentucky National Guard; make amendments retroactive to May 30, 2020; EMERGENCY.
